零基础轻松入门:你的脚本语言自学指南26


在当今数字时代,脚本语言已经渗透到我们生活的方方面面,从简单的自动化任务到复杂的网站后端开发,甚至人工智能领域,都能见到它们的身影。 许多人渴望掌握这项技术,却不知从何入手。 本文将为你提供一份详细的自学指南,助你轻松踏上脚本语言学习之旅。

一、选择你的第一门脚本语言

市面上存在许多种脚本语言,例如Python、JavaScript、PHP、Ruby、Perl等等,每种语言都有其擅长的领域和应用场景。 初学者往往会感到迷茫,不知该如何选择。 这里推荐几种适合入门级的脚本语言:
Python: Python以其简洁易懂的语法和丰富的库而闻名,被广泛应用于数据科学、机器学习、Web开发等领域。 其庞大的社区支持也为初学者提供了丰富的学习资源。
JavaScript: 如果你对Web开发感兴趣,JavaScript是必不可少的技能。 它运行在浏览器端,可以实现动态网页效果、交互式应用等。 学习JavaScript也能让你更好地理解前端开发。
Bash (Shell Scripting): 如果你想提升Linux系统的操作效率,学习Bash脚本是不错的选择。 它可以自动化各种系统管理任务,例如文件备份、批量处理等。

建议根据你的兴趣和职业规划选择合适的语言。 如果你对数据分析感兴趣,Python是不错的选择;如果你想做Web开发,JavaScript是必不可少的;如果你想管理服务器,Bash脚本将大有裨益。 初学者通常建议从Python开始,因为它相对容易上手,学习曲线较为平缓。

二、制定学习计划并坚持执行

学习任何技能都需要一个合理的计划和持之以恒的努力。 制定一个切实可行的学习计划,并坚持执行非常重要。 你的计划可以包括以下几个方面:
设定明确的目标: 例如,在三个月内掌握Python基础语法,完成一个简单的项目等。
选择合适的学习资源: 在线课程(例如Coursera、edX、Udacity)、书籍、官方文档、在线教程等都是不错的选择。 选择适合自己学习风格的资源。
制定学习时间表: 每天或每周安排固定的时间进行学习,并坚持下去。 即使时间很短,也要保持学习的连续性。
实践练习: 学习编程的关键在于实践。 多做练习题,完成一些小项目,可以有效巩固所学知识。
记录学习笔记: 记录学习过程中遇到的问题、解决方法以及心得体会,方便日后复习和查阅。


三、利用有效的学习资源

学习脚本语言,资源的选择至关重要。以下是一些推荐的学习资源:
在线课程平台: Coursera、edX、Udacity、MOOC等平台提供了大量的编程课程,涵盖各种脚本语言。
官方文档: 每种脚本语言都有官方文档,这是学习最权威、最可靠的资源。
书籍: 一些优秀的编程书籍可以帮助你系统地学习脚本语言的知识和技巧。
在线社区: Stack Overflow、GitHub等在线社区提供了丰富的学习资源和技术支持,你可以在这里提问、寻求帮助,并与其他开发者交流学习。
视频教程: YouTube、Bilibili等视频网站上有很多优秀的编程视频教程,可以帮助你更好地理解一些抽象的概念。


四、从简单项目开始,逐步提升

学习编程不能只停留在理论阶段,必须进行大量的实践。 建议从一些简单的小项目开始,例如:
编写一个简单的计算器程序: 可以练习基本语法和运算符的使用。
编写一个文件处理程序: 可以练习文件读写操作。
编写一个简单的网页爬虫: 可以练习网络请求和数据解析。
开发一个简单的游戏: 可以练习游戏逻辑设计和程序控制。

随着项目的逐渐复杂,你的编程能力也会得到提升。 在完成项目的过程中,你可能会遇到各种各样的问题,这正是学习和成长的机会。 积极寻求解决方案,并从中总结经验,你将收获良多。

五、持续学习,不断精进

脚本语言技术日新月异,持续学习非常重要。 要保持对新技术的敏感性,不断学习新的知识和技能。 可以关注行业动态、参加技术交流活动、阅读技术博客等。

学习编程是一个长期的过程,需要耐心和毅力。 不要害怕犯错,从错误中学习,不断总结经验,你最终会成为一名优秀的程序员。 祝你学习顺利!

2025-04-02


上一篇:Lua脚本语言调用详解:从基础到高级应用

下一篇:选择最佳脚本语言及对应软件:高效开发的利器